A dish of a larger size is in the National Museum, Stockholm (inv.no. NMK 59/1947). Other examples of oval trays in different sizes are in the Detroit Institute of Art, Detroit, the Carnegie Museum of Art, Pittsburg, the Muzeum Narodowe, Warsaw, the Museum für angewandte Kunst, Cologne and the Ernst Schneider Collection in Schloss Lustheim, near Munich (illustrated in U. Pietsch (ed.), Schwanenservice - Meissener Porzellan für Heinrich Graf von Brühl, 2000, p.155, no. 23). An unpainted version is in the collection of the Museum für Kunst und Gewerbe, Hamburg.
Another example of the same dish was sold at Bonhams, London, 3 December 2024, lot 150.
See U. Pietsch, Schwanenservice, 2000, for a comprehensive discussion of the service, and Maureen Cassidy-Geiger, "From Barlow to Büggel," in Keramos, 119 (1988): 54-68, for a discussion of the graphic sources.
